Commonwealth v. Dressel

110 Mass. 102
Massachusetts Supreme Judicial Court·Decided September 15, 1872·Published·Cited by 3 cases

Opinion

By the Court.

That the exceptions must be sustained is settled by the case of Commonwealth v. Phelps, 11 Gray, 72. That a new trial is proper is settled by Commonwealth v. Doty, 2 Met 18. Exceptions sustained; new trial ordered.
